        The for and devices is designed to provide designers with an easy to use, economical development environment for 16-bit Digital Signal Controllers and Microcontrollers.

        provides all you need to get started at a very low cost. It has an integrated programmer / debugger. It can be used stand-alone or plugged into a prototyping board for extremely flexible development. The device under test is socketed for easy change-out, and Microchip’s MPLAB Integrated Development Environment supports .         板Microstick主要特性:

        Low Cost – Priced at $24.99 at Microchip Direct

        Integrated USB programmer / debugger – No external debugger required

        USB Powered – Ease of use, No external power required

        Socketed dsPIC/PIC24 – Flexible, Easy device replacement

        0.025” Pin headers – Enables plug-in to Breadboard with room for jumper wires

        Easy access to all device signals for probing

        Small size - Smaller than a stick of gum at 20 x76mm – Easily Portable

        On board debug LED, Utility LED and Reset Switch

        Free demo code
